2 out of 5 stars ennui.......2004-06-11

Passage's droning delivery and offkilter approach to hiphop is definately in line with the anticon sound. Unlike his peers, Passage lacks the punch that have established Sole, Jel, and Dose. I would definately view him as an anticon junior member...this disc is an attestation to his ever complex struggle for defining himself amidst pressurized beats with 80's samples and self edifying moments of presumed insight. Although this disc isn't horrible, I would this disc only if you are a fan of passage's other work like newbliette (oubliette). The beats, while interesting and bearing that "lo fi" asthetic that makes the indy kids sweat, only exacerbates passage's inane sing songy voice. This only works towards his advantage on "The Unstrung Harp" where the modal sample and Passage's voice click into place...moments like these are few and far between in my opinion.

3 out of 5 stars Anticon: Music for the ages?.......2004-06-04

I have long been a fan of Anticon records, perhaps 5 - 6 years. I have watched the label grow to be a new form of music rather than just a new form of hip-hop. This is especially true with the new PASSAGE disk Forcefeild Kids. The disk is full of folk rock/ Post Hip-Hop/ Art rock/ Stream of conciseness. No matter what you are into you will most likely find a taste of it on this disk. My personal favorite tracks are 3. Creature in the classroom, 9. The Kareoki (sp?) Kiss Ass, and 11. Jail 4 Lil Geniuses. #3 is a good blend of passage's singsong cadence with his abstract, yet forward, rhyme style. #9 is a sick little song, a little of the newer style. #11 is very reminiscent of the Restiform Bodies work. The same intensity is very evident on much of the disk, yet the production separates it from the Restiform work. What seems to be a new trend in the Anticon camp, self-production is a big part of this disk. All in all I would say if you own any anticon disks, pick this one up. As a fan who owns over thirty albums, I would say it was well worth the $14.
